About the role:

CrowdStrike is seeking an experienced Data Center Tooling Engineer to join the Data Center Infrastructure team. Our data centers are the foundation upon which our rapidly scaling infrastructure efficiently operates and upon which our innovative services are delivered. This person should enjoy working in a fast-paced environment where adaptability and flexibility will be key to their success.

The candidate we seek is a forward thinking IT professional with deep experience applying and developing software tooling and automation solutions, to address complex operational issues.

The ideal candidate should have a strong background in software architecture, be comfortable working independently, and confident enough to suggest solutions. They should also be a natural collaborator, able to distill the needs of stakeholders and subject matter experts and translate these into long-term automated solutions. Extensive knowledge of managing servers, DCIM automation, programming/scripting, and performing complex projects in a large-scale, distributed data center environment is an advantage.

Although this is primarily a software development role (Python experience preferred), we're looking for someone that also has an intermediate-level understanding of engineering concepts such as IPMI, network routing and subnets, the physical layout and connections of both stand-alone and chassis servers, and SNMP to name a few examples.

What You'll Do:
  • Assist with the development, deployment and maintenance of a wide variety of automation software, including but not limited to:
    • API development
    • Custom tooling development affecting server hardware
    • Asset security auditing and verification
    • Troubleshooting and triage
    • Composing thorough unit and integration tests
    • Report generation
  • DCIM asset creation and auditing
  • Create documentation both for developers and end-users
  • Provide training for developed applications and tools to other engineers and technicians
  • Participate in organization-wide major initiatives and cross functional group projects
  • Perform other duties as needed or assigned
What You'll Need:
  • 5+ years of software engineering experience
  • 3+ years combined experience with Linux based operating systems
  • 2+ years experience working closely with Data Center Systems and Architecture
  • 2+ years combined experience in server hardware, networking and systems management
  • 1+ years experience working with a Data Center Inventory Management Tool (DCIM)
  • Varsity-level Python programming
  • Solid design- and problem-solving skills
  • Proficiency with modern version control systems
  • Ability to plan, organize and prioritize work independently and meet deadlines
  • Ability to translate technical details into simple terminology both verbally and in writing
  • Ability to use independent judgment to make justifiable decisions while problem solving
  • Ability to work in a dynamic, fast-paced and high visibility environment
  • Ability to manage expectations and provide proactive status updates
  • Ability to effectively work with and communicate with all levels of staff
  • Demonstrable ability to prioritize and execute tasks in a methodical and disciplined manner
  • High level of organization when performing tasks related to concurrent project priorities
